Master Mover guide for Moving Out: Learn how to complete levels without breaking items to unlock this challenging achievement. Tips and strategies included.
Walkthrough
- 1Understand the Condition: The "Master Mover" achievement requires you to complete levels without breaking any items. This means no smashing vases, no shattering glass, and no damaging fragile objects.
- 2Prioritize Safety: Focus on carefully moving items, especially fragile ones, to the truck. Avoid throwing items unnecessarily or rushing through areas where breakable objects are present.
- 3Environmental Hazards: Be aware of environmental hazards that could lead to item breakage. For example, in "Holly's Home," breaking windows is an objective, so you must avoid this if aiming for "Master Mover." In "Poolside Pad," avoid letting objects fall into the pool.
- 4Specific Level Challenges: Some levels have objectives that directly conflict with the "Master Mover" condition (e.g., "Break the windows" in Holly's Home). For these levels, you will need to ignore or find alternative ways to complete the level objectives without breaking items.
- 5Utilize Teammates (Co-op): If playing in co-op, coordinate with your partner to ensure items are handled safely. One player can clear a path while the other carries fragile items.
- 6Patience is Key: This achievement demands patience. Take your time, plan your routes, and don't be afraid to restart a level if you accidentally break an item.
- 7Focus on Non-Fragile Items First: When possible, move non-fragile items first to clear space and reduce the risk of accidentally knocking over or breaking something fragile.
Tips
- The "Don't Break any glass" and "Don't Break any Objects" objectives in "Jerry's Apartment" are direct examples of the "Master Mover" condition.
- Pay close attention to the "Don't Break any windows" objective in "The Hoop House" and ensure you do not break any.
- In levels with environmental objectives like "Keep everything dry" (Poolside Pad), ensure your item handling doesn't lead to breakage or loss.
- The game's physics can be unforgiving. Practice moving items slowly and deliberately.
- If playing solo, consider the "Assisted" mode for slightly more forgiving controls, though the core challenge of not breaking items remains.
Completing all 30 levels without breaking any items will unlock the "Master Mover" achievement.
